Does American First Class get priority security?

Flagship First perks at the airport First class passengers can use priority check-in lines and accelerated security queues at some airports.



Yes, in 2026, a First Class ticket on American Airlines typically includes access to Priority Security lanes at participating airports. This benefit is part of the "Priority" privileges package, which also covers priority check-in and boarding. For those flying in Flagship® First (specifically on high-end transcontinental or international routes), you may even have access to the exclusive Flagship® First Check-In, which provides a private entrance and a direct, expedited path to the front of the security line in select hub cities like LAX, JFK, and DFW. On your boarding pass, you should look for the "Priority" or "Group 1" designation to confirm your eligibility. However, it is important to note that "Priority Security" is not the same as TSA PreCheck; while you get to skip the long line, you may still be required to remove your shoes and laptop unless you also have the PreCheck benefit, so many First Class travelers in 2026 continue to use both to maximize their speed.

As we mentioned, the easiest way to get priority boarding with American Airlines is to fly in a premium cabin. First class passengers board in Group 1; business class passengers board in Groups 1 and 2; and premium economy passengers board in Group 4.
